Solution for y^2=13y equation:


Simplifying
y2 = 13y

Solving
y2 = 13y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Reorder the terms:
-13y + y2 = 13y + -13y

Combine like terms: 13y + -13y = 0
-13y + y2 = 0

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), 'y'.
y(-13 + y)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or 'y'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ying y = 0 Solving y = 0 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ying y = 0

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(-13 + y)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ying -13 + y = 0 Solving -13 + y = 0 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'13' to each side of the equation. -13 + 13 + y = 0 + 13 Combine like terms: -13 + 13 = 0 0 + y = 0 + 13 y = 0 + 13 Combine like terms: 0 + 13 = 13 y = 13 Simplifying y = 13

Solution

y = {0, 13}
